Budweiser’s Made in America Festival Takes Over The Statue of Liberty & Governors Island on Sunday, June 21st

The Budweiser Made in America Festival will taking over two New York City landmarks – The Statue of Liberty and Governor’s Island to present two unique concerts. Call these ‘pre-gaming’ for the official Budweiser Made in America Festival which will take place in Philadelphia on September 5 and September 6.

The first show, the big show dubbed Made in America Statue of Liberty (which is already sold-out) will feature a performance by legendary R&B singer Mary J. Blige.

According to the festival’s official site, due to the overwhelming response to the Mary J. show, they have added a second ‘macro’ experience on Governors Island the same night. This concert, which is free (but you must register to win tickets), will feature performances by EDM superstars Big Gigantic, autotone auteur T. Pain, and white indie-alt sensations, Misterwives.
